Is 110261648 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
No, 110 261 648 is not a prime number.
For example, 110 261 648 can be divided by 2: 110 261 648 / 2 = 55 130 824.
For 110 261 648 to be a prime number, it would have been required that 110 261 648 has only two divisors, i.e., itself and 1.
